**
*romeo *
вроде, нормально написано, но я не пойму ((( объясните, пожалуйста, алгоритм на примере...
откуда что получили?
откуда что получили?
N - это число элементов в массиве, поэтому N=10. Ближайшее число из последовательности Фибоначчи, которое >10 - это 13, поэтому F=13.
N+M+1=F. подставляем: 10+M+1=13. Отсюда M=2.
i=F=8, P=F=5, H=F=3 - это всё значения ближайших чисел в последовательности.
т.к. A>K, пользуемся формулой i=i-M, т.е., i=8-2=6.
А вот дальнейшее для меня загадка. Видимо, это как-то связано с деревьями Фебоначчи и значения I,P,H берутся по веткам..